You Receive: In-depth entrepreneurship training; One-on-one business coaching and counselling to set up your business; Help in developing a detailed business plan; Income support of $306 per week for up to 22 weeks.
To qualify for the program, you must be: Between 15 and 30 years of age (inclusive) at the time of intake/selection; NOT in full time school or NOT working full time; Must be available to make a full time commitment; A Canadian citizen, permanent resident, or a person on whom refugee status has been conferred; Legally entitled to work according to the regulations in vogue in the Province of British Columbia; Not in receipt of Employment Insurance (EI) benefits; In need of assistance to overcome employment barriers.
